Recipes From Jail Dinners

By

Caitlin

Caitlin writes from Mid North Coast Correctional Centre, New South Wales.

Chicken Kebab Marinade

1 part = 1 tablespoon

Ingredients:

  • Soy sauce (2 parts)
  • ABC sauce (1 part)
  • Honey (1 part)
  • Garlic (1 tsp)

Method:

  1. Shredded chicken (Enough for 1 person, use more if eating with others)
  2. Mix together, use water (a little) if needed

Ham Carbonara

Feeds about 8 people.

Ingredients:

  • 2 packets of carbonara pasta
  • Ham (from ham/salad dinners  –  use enough from 6 dinners)
  • 1 cream
  • ½ packet rice stick noodles
  • Mixed herbs

Method:

  1. Cut the rinds off the ham. Dice into small pieces and cook on the cooktop with butter and  garlic.
  2. Cook up the carbonara packs in separate mixing bowls.
  3. Break rice stick noodles up and cook in hot water for 5–10 mins. Drain and add half into each carbonara.
  4. Add cream (½ into each bowl) towards the end of microwaving carbonara pasta.
  5. Once pasta is finished cooking in the microwave, add bacon and herbs into the pasta. Mix thoroughly.
